TROUBLESHOOTING DIESEL FUEL 13A-464 STEP 4. Check injector identification code. • Check injector identification code (Refer to GROUP 00 − Precautions Before Service − Injec- tor Identification code Registration Procedure ). Q: Is the check result normal? YES : Go to Step 5 . NO : Register the injector ID. STEP 5. Supply pump correction learning. • Carry out the supply pump correction learning (Refer to GROUP 00 − Precautions Before Serv- ice − Supply Pump Correction Learning ). Q: Does trouble symptom persist? YES : Go to Step 6 . NO : The procedure is complete. STEP 6. Small injection quantity learning. • Carry out the small injection quantity learning procedure (Refer to GROUP 00 − Precautions Before Service − Small Injection Quantity Learn- ing Procedure ). Q: Does trouble symptom persist? YES : Go to Step 7 . NO : The procedure is complete. STEP 7. Confirm the using fuel. Q: Is the specified fuel being used? YES : Go to Step 8 . NO : Replace fuel. STEP 8. Check glow system. • Check glow system (Refer to Code No. P0381 <Euro5> or Inspection Procedure 25 <Except Euro5>). Q: Is the check result normal? YES : Go to Step 9 . NO : Repair or replace the failed item. STEP 9. Check fuel supply line. • Check for fuel leakage and clogging. • Check fuel filter for clogging. Q: Is the check result normal? YES : Go to Step 10 . NO : Repair or replace the failed item. STEP 10. Priming (air bleeding) • Bleed air. Q: Does trouble symptom persist? YES : Go to Step 11 . NO : The procedure is complete. STEP 11. M.U.T.-III actuator test. • Refer to Actuator Test Reference Table a. Item 19: Suction control valve Q: Is the check result normal? YES : Go to Step 12 . NO : Replace the suction control valve.
